The Next Big Thing: Innovation - FULLY BOOKED

  • Date:26/05/2011
  • Time:9.00-12.30
  • Venue details:KPMG, 15 Canada Square, London E14 5GL
  • Cost:Free

Social Enterprise London is continuing its partnership with world leading professional services firm KPMG to deliver another FREE programme of training to social enterprises based in London which are ready to grow.

The fifth of these is Innovation, which will take place on Thursday 26th May at the KPMG offices in Canary Wharf.

This session will provide training in:

    * An understanding of what ‘innovation’ means in a business environment
    * How to use innovative practice to maximise resource efficiency
    * Understanding how the social enterprise model gives the opportunity to achieve greater efficiency
